Best Schools in Valley Water Mills, MO
Valley Water Mills, MO has a total of 9 schools including 3 high schools, 3 middle schools and 3 elementary schools. A total of 4,183 students attend Valley Water Mills, MO schools. On average, schools in Valley Water Mills score 41%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 40%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Valley Water Mills me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Valley Water Mills, MO
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Valley Water Mills, MO has a total population of 463 with 29%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 91%, and 29%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
